The following information relates to James Company:

Date                                  Ending inventory (end-of year prices)                     Price Index

December 31, 2016                           $154,000                                                100

December 31, 2017                           $196,768                                                104

December 31, 2018                            $205,656                                               114

December 31, 2019                             $228,448                                              118

December 31, 2020                             $211,200                                              120

Instructions

Problem (a) Use the dollar-value LIFO method to compute the ending inventory for James Company for 2016 through 2020.

Problem (b) Find the LIFO reserve and LIFO effect for each year.

Problem (c) Prepare the necessary journal entries to record the LIFO effect in each period.
